Ames Department Stores, Inc., is a regional, full-line discount retailer with an associate base of 21,500 and annual sales of approximately $2.7 billion. With stores in the Northeast, Mid-Atlantic and Mid-West, Ames offers value-conscious shoppers quality, name-brand products across a broad range of merchandise categories.
